What Happens to Your Blood Sugar When You Fast?

If you have ever gone too long without eating and started feeling shaky, foggy, irritable, weak, or lightheaded, your body may have been giving you useful information.

That does not mean fasting is automatically bad. It also does not mean you are weak or undisciplined.

It means your body is working to keep your blood sugar stable without new fuel coming in from food.

Your body has several backup systems for this. They are impressive, but they are not magic. How well they work depends on your health, stress level, sleep, activity, medications, eating history, metabolic flexibility, and how long you have gone without eating.

Understanding what happens during fasting can help you make smarter decisions about meal timing, blood sugar stability, weight loss attempts, intermittent fasting, and metabolic health.

First, What Is Blood Glucose?

Blood glucose is the amount of glucose, or sugar, circulating in your bloodstream.

Glucose comes largely from carbohydrate-containing foods such as fruit, grains, beans, milk, yogurt, and starchy vegetables. After digestion, glucose enters the bloodstream and becomes available for cells to use as energy.


Your brain and red blood cells are especially dependent on a steady energy supply. The brain can use other fuels, such as ketones, during longer fasting or carbohydrate restriction, but glucose still plays a major role in everyday energy and thinking. This is why blood sugar stability matters.


When blood glucose drops too low or fluctuates quickly, some people may feel symptoms such as:

  • shakiness

  • dizziness

  • irritability

  • fatigue

  • brain fog

  • sweating

  • weakness

  • headaches

  • intense hunger

  • difficulty concentrating


These symptoms are not always caused by blood sugar, but they are worth paying attention to, especially if they improve after eating.


Your Body Does Not Immediately Run Out of Fuel

When you stop eating for a while, your body does not immediately panic.


It has a sequence of backup systems.


A simple way to think about it is this:


Your body first uses glucose from food, then stored glucose, then makes new glucose if needed.


The details are more complex, but that basic sequence helps explain why fasting can feel fine for one person and awful for another.


Step One: Using Stored Glucose

After you eat, some glucose is used right away for energy. Some is stored for later.

The stored form of glucose is called glycogen.


You can think of glycogen as your body’s short-term glucose savings account. It is stored mainly in the liver and muscles.


When you are fasting and no new glucose is coming in from food, your liver can break down glycogen and release glucose into the bloodstream. This process is called glycogenolysis.


In plain language:

Glycogenolysis means breaking down stored glucose so your body can use it.


This helps keep blood sugar from dropping too low during the early part of fasting.

Liver glycogen can help maintain blood glucose for roughly 12 to 24 hours, though this varies. Activity level, prior carbohydrate intake, metabolic health, liver glycogen stores, and overall nutrition can all influence how long this backup supply lasts.


This is one reason someone who ate enough carbohydrates the day before may feel different during a fast than someone who was already under-eating, exercising heavily, stressed, or eating very low carbohydrate.


Step Two: When Stored Glucose Runs Low

Eventually, the body’s stored glucose starts to decline.


At that point, the liver has to do more than open the glycogen “savings account.” It begins creating glucose from other available materials, including parts of protein, lactate, and glycerol from fat metabolism.


This is one reason people can go through periods without food and still maintain blood glucose. The body has a backup plan.


But backup plans still cost energy.


For some people, especially those who are under-eating, stressed, sleeping poorly, very active, or changing their diet abruptly, this transition may not feel smooth. They may feel shaky, foggy, irritable, or drained before their body has fully adjusted.


Why Some People Feel Terrible When They Fast

Some people can go several hours without eating and feel fine.


Others feel like their brain has left the building.


That difference can come from many factors, including:

  • blood sugar regulation

  • insulin sensitivity

  • stress hormones

  • sleep quality

  • meal composition

  • hydration

  • medication use

  • menstrual cycle changes

  • activity level

  • history of dieting or under-eating

  • history of disordered eating

  • diabetes or metabolic syndrome

  • bariatric surgery or digestive changes

  • adrenal, thyroid, or other medical conditions


Fasting is not just a behavior. It is a metabolic demand.


For some bodies, that demand is manageable. For others, it may be too much, especially when combined with calorie restriction, low carbohydrate intake, intense exercise, or chronic stress.


A better question than “Why can’t I handle fasting?” is:


What is my body already managing, and is fasting adding more stress than support right now?


Insulin and Glucagon: The Body’s Traffic Signals

Blood sugar is partly regulated by hormones that tell the body when to store fuel and when to release it.


After eating, insulin helps move glucose out of the bloodstream and into cells, where it can be used or stored. During fasting, glucagon helps signal the liver to make stored fuel available again.


In a well-regulated system, these signals help keep blood glucose from swinging too high or too low.


But if someone has insulin resistance, diabetes, irregular eating patterns, high stress, medication effects, or other metabolic concerns, those signals may not work as smoothly. That is one reason fasting can feel very different from person to person.


What About Cortisol?

Cortisol is another hormone that can affect blood sugar.


Cortisol is often called a stress hormone, but it is not “bad.” You need cortisol to wake up, respond to stress, regulate inflammation, and maintain blood pressure and energy availability.


During stress or prolonged fasting, cortisol can help make more fuel available. One way it does this is by supporting glucose production.


The problem is that chronic stress, poor sleep, under-eating, and aggressive fasting can keep the body under more strain than it can comfortably manage.


That does not mean cortisol is the villain. It means context matters.


If someone is already exhausted, anxious, sleeping poorly, or underfed, adding fasting may not be the most supportive first step.


Why Balanced Meals Help Blood Sugar Stability

One practical way to support steadier blood sugar is to eat balanced meals. That does not mean every meal has to be perfect. It means including a mix of nutrients that slow digestion and provide longer-lasting energy.


A helpful meal structure includes:

  • protein

  • fiber

  • fat

  • carbohydrates that work well for your body


For example:

  • eggs with toast and avocado

  • Greek yogurt with berries and nuts

  • oatmeal with protein added

  • chicken, rice, vegetables, and olive oil

  • beans with rice, salsa, and avocado

  • tuna or tofu with crackers and vegetables

  • a smoothie with protein, fruit, and nut butter


Protein, fiber, and fat can slow glucose absorption and help reduce sharp spikes and crashes. Highly refined carbohydrates eaten alone may cause a faster rise and fall in blood glucose for some people, which can contribute to hunger, fatigue, irritability, or cravings.


This does not mean carbohydrates are bad.


It means carbohydrates often work better when they are part of a meal that also includes protein, fiber, and fat.


Should You Use Supplements for Blood Sugar?

Some supplements are marketed for blood sugar support. One example is alpha-lipoic acid, often called ALA. Some research suggests ALA may modestly improve fasting blood glucose or markers of insulin resistance in certain people with type 2 diabetes. But supplements are not a substitute for regular meals, appropriate medication, sleep, movement, stress support, or medical care. Supplements can also interact with medications or be inappropriate for certain health conditions.


So the honest answer is this: ALA may be worth discussing with a qualified healthcare provider for some people, but it should not be treated as the main strategy for blood sugar regulation. The boring basics still matter more than the shiny supplement.


Fasting Is Not Right for Everyone

Fasting can be helpful for some people in some contexts.


But it is not universally safe or beneficial.


Extra caution is important for people with:

  • diabetes or hypoglycemia

  • a history of eating disorders or disordered eating

  • pregnancy or breastfeeding

  • bariatric surgery history

  • adrenal or thyroid concerns

  • kidney or liver disease

  • medications that affect blood sugar

  • high training loads or physically demanding jobs

  • chronic stress or poor sleep

  • a history of fainting, dizziness, or unstable eating patterns


For these individuals, fasting may require medical guidance or may not be appropriate at all.

This is where diet culture gets dangerous. It often sells fasting as a discipline test. But fasting is not morally superior to eating breakfast. It is just one tool, and not every tool belongs in every hand.


When to Pay Attention to Symptoms

Feeling mildly hungry before a meal is normal.


Feeling shaky, faint, confused, sweaty, panicky, or unable to function is not something to ignore.


Consider seeking medical guidance if you experience:

  • frequent dizziness or fainting

  • symptoms that improve rapidly after eating

  • confusion or severe weakness

  • shakiness, sweating, or heart racing

  • symptoms during fasting or after high-carbohydrate meals

  • intense fatigue that is new or worsening

  • unintended weight loss

  • blood sugar concerns

  • symptoms while taking diabetes medications


Symptoms are not moral failures.


They are information.


What Clinicians Should Remember

When a patient feels worse during fasting, calorie restriction, or weight-loss attempts, the answer is not automatically “try harder.”


Clinicians need to understand the body’s backup systems so they can distinguish normal adaptation, poor fit, and possible metabolic dysfunction.


Helpful clinical questions include:

  • How long is the person fasting?

  • What did they eat before the fast?

  • Are they eating enough overall?

  • Are they combining fasting with low carbohydrate intake?

  • Are they taking medications that affect blood glucose?

  • Do they have diabetes, insulin resistance, or metabolic syndrome?

  • Do they have a history of eating disorder behaviors?

  • Are they sleeping poorly or under chronic stress?

  • Are symptoms mild, or are they impairing function?


Understanding glycogenolysis, gluconeogenesis, insulin, glucagon, and cortisol helps clinicians guide people more safely through fasting, weight loss, metabolic health changes, and dietary transitions.


It also helps clinicians avoid shaming patients for symptoms that may have a real physiological basis.


The Bottom Line

When you fast, your body works to keep blood glucose stable.


First, it uses stored glucose. As those stores decline, it begins producing glucose from other sources. Hormones such as insulin, glucagon, and cortisol help coordinate that process.

For some people, this system works smoothly. For others, fasting can trigger fatigue, shakiness, irritability, brain fog, or dizziness.


That does not mean your body is broken.


It may mean the plan needs to change.


Sometimes the most supportive choice is not pushing through.


Sometimes it is eating regularly, balancing meals, sleeping more, reducing stress, adjusting medication with a clinician, or choosing a slower path.
